Résumé

The objective of this invited review is to describe the introduction and development of the GnRH agonist (GnRHa) trigger protocol in modern in vitro fertilization, focusing on ovarian hyperstimulation syndrome (OHSS) prevention and, equally important on the role of GnRHa trigger as an opener of the luteal phase "black box." The GnRHa trigger and freezing of all embryos is the ultimate weapon against OHSS in the OHSS-risk patient. In the non OHSS-risk patient, GnRHa trigger followed by a modified luteal phase support with lutein hormone activity and subsequent fresh embryo transfer results in excellent reproductive outcomes. Thus, the GnRHa trigger has paved the way for a virtually OHSS-free clinic, and equally important is the fact that the early lessons learned from studying the GnRHa trigger opened the "black box" of the luteal phase enabling improved reproductive outcomes in both fresh and frozen embryo transfer cycles.
